Enhancing Manufacturing and Production Efficiency

In the realm of manufacturing and production, digitalization has ushered in an era often referred to as Industry 4.0. This involves the integration of advanced technologies such as the Internet of Things (IoT), artificial intelligence (AI), and automation into factory floors. These innovations enable smart factories where machines communicate, data is analyzed in real-time, and production processes are optimized for maximum efficiency, reduced downtime, and higher quality output. This technological leap significantly impacts enterprise production capabilities.

Streamlining Global Logistics and Supply Chains

The complexities of global operations are significantly simplified through digitalization, particularly in logistics and supply chain management. Digital tools provide enhanced visibility across the entire supply chain, from raw material sourcing to final product delivery. Real-time tracking, predictive analytics for inventory management, and automated warehousing systems contribute to greater transparency and responsiveness. This leads to more efficient resource allocation, reduced operational costs, and improved resilience against disruptions in the global supply network.
